Working with Water in Medieval Europe
Biographical note
Paolo Squatriti, Ph.D. (1990) in History, University of Virginia, teaches Medieval European History at the University of Michigan. His publications on Early Medieval Italian History include Water and Society in Early Medieval Italy (Cambridge U.P., 1998).
Readership
Those interested in Medieval Europe, in the history of science and technology, environmental history, and pre-modern societies.

Table of contents
List of Illustrations.....
List of Contributors.....
Introduction / Paolo Squatriti.....
Ch. 1: Waterpower in Medieval Ireland / Colin Rynne.....1
Ch. 2: Medieval England's Water-Related Technologies / Richard Holt.....51
Ch. 3: Hydraulic Engineering in the Netherlands during the Middle Ages / William H. TeBrake.....101
Ch. 4: Water Technology in Medieval Germany / Klaus Grewe.....129
Ch. 5: Medieval Hydraulics in France / Paul Benoit, Josephine Rouillard.....161
Ch. 6: The Technologies of Water in Medieval Italy / Roberta Magnusson, Paolo Squatriti.....217
Ch. 7: Hydraulic Systems and Technologies of Islamic Spain: History and Archaeology / Thomas F. Glick, Helena Kirchner.....267
Ch. 8: Medieval Fishing / Richard Hoffmann.....331
Bibliography.....395
Index.....437
